The peer-to-peer ride-sharing mobile app Lyft is now operating at the Greater Cincinnati/Northern Kentucky International Airport.
“Our customers want options,” said Candace McGraw, CVG CEO. “Lyft joins other ground transportation options including rental cars, taxi cabs, On-Demand Van/Shuttle and TANK.”
“People in Cincinnati have embraced Lyft as an affordable, convenient way to get around their city and we’re excited to be the first ride-sharing partner of Cincinnati/Northern Kentucky International Airport,” said Bakari Brock, Lyft’s Director of Business Development. “We’d like to thank Lisa Ransom, Kim Collins, Paul Wischer and all the CVG staff for welcoming modern options like Lyft to the airport.”
“We strive to be innovative,” said Wm. T. (Bill) Robinson III, Kenton County Airport Board Chairman. “CVG is the first airport in Ohio and Kentucky to have an operating agreement with Lyft.”
Passengers using the Lyft app on their smartphone will request a ride. Once the driver and passenger are paired, the driver will pick up their passenger at the far west end of passenger pick-up. This area will be marked with overhead signage.
